Psychoeducational Assessment Overview
These assessments clearly show what your kid thinks, learns, etc. It explores their brain wiring to understand what's easy or challenging for them. Such insights further help make their school life more empowering and less troublesome. However, only a registered psychologist can conduct a psychoeducational assessment. You can talk to them for remote psycho educational assessment also if required. Typically, this facility is available only for slightly older children, starting at age eight and up. At the same time, you may have to create a proper setup to make the virtual process hassle-free. The experts can assess your kid's academic skills, executive functioning, visual-motor coordination, intellectual power, memory, etc.

Intellectual Abilities
During the online assessment, the evaluator can use standardized tools to test your kid's working memory, learning speed, quick utilization of new information, verbal reasoning, etc. This method lets you discover whether your child has any intellectual disability or requires a unique learning atmosphere with proper tools. The same technique can also reveal if your child is highly intellectual.

Executive Functioning (EF)
If your kid has focus issues, keeps losing items, or cannot remember instructions, a comprehensive assessment like this can help detect their underlying problem. During an online session, your kid may undergo clinical interviews, perform EF-based tasks, etc. These assess the kid's impulse control, reading, writing, verbal efficiency, focus, concentration, cognitive flexibility, etc. This type of virtual psycho educational assessment helps with ADHD diagnosis. It can make you understand your child better and provide the appropriate environment for his growth.

Academic Skills
The online assessment can also test your kid’s primary academic skills, such as math, reading, and writing. It helps detect specific learning problems in the kids. Suppose the kid struggles in comprehension and reading. It can be linked to dyslexia. Someone facing challenges with expression and writing can be suffering from dysgraphia. If the kid is weak in number concepts and math, they can face a problem called dyscalculia. Such discoveries help you create proper methods and systems for your kid to improve his learning conditions.

Visual-Motor Coordination
Also called hand-eye coordination, this test requires the kids to interpret their visual cues and respond to them with adequate gross and fine motor skills. These tests help understand the kid’s planning, execution, and monitoring abilities.

Memory
Suppose the kid doesn’t have attention or cognitive functioning issues. Instead, he can be having an underlying memory-related problem. Psychoeducational assessments can be designed to understand whether the child has a problem with immediate recall, visual memory, primary memory, working memory, etc.
